Summary
Modernizing Disclosures for Investors Act This bill requires the Securities and Exchange Commission to allow issuers of securities traded on a national securities exchange to meet quarterly financial disclosure requirements via an alternative method, such as through a press release or a shortened form. (Currently, such issuers must disclose information quarterly through Form 10-Q.)
